A 14-year-old New Zealand Defence Force cadet has been awarded for saving the life of a stabbing victim in Christchurch.On December 6, Cadet Seth Whale, from the No.18 Squadron, Air Training Corps, was nearby when a person was critically stabbed in Hoon Hay.Whilst others assisted the person to the ground, Whale grabbed a towel and applied direct pressure to the wound until ambulance staff arrived.The teen had attended a one-day Red Cross Essential First Aid Course a week earlier.Commandant of the Cadet Forces Commander Andrew Law said, while the course provided Cadet Whale with the knowledge, it was his courage and determination that empowered him to take action in a critical first aid situation."CDT Whale's efforts during this traumatic incident demonstrated well the values of the New Zealand Cadet Forces, and were a key component in saving a human life.
